## Deploying the Gatewick Proctor Queue

Deploys are pretty painless: push to main, wait for the pipeline, then watch the queue drain dashboard for five minutes. If candidates pile up mid-exam, roll back first and ask questions later — the queue replays safely. Everything the workers care about lives in one config block, shown here for reference.

settings of bafof-yagef:
JOROX_PIN=8740
JOROX_TENANT=pelox
JOROX_METRICS_HOST=metrics.jorox.qorvelworks.internal
JOROX_SEAL=seal_c78f63c1
JOROX_STANDBY_TEAM=norax

## Deployment

Pebblecast is a chatty service, so we sample logs aggressively in production to keep storage costs sane. The support team should know that only one in fifty info-level lines is retained, while warnings and errors are always kept in full. If a customer report needs more detail, sampling can be raised temporarily via a redeploy — never edit the running pod. The deployed sampling configuration is shown below.

deployment values, fawef-tawef:
[gilox]
host = gilox.olvarqsoft.corp
user = gilox_svc
database = gilox_prod

- [ ] Verify the Korvix partner SFTP drop before sealing keys. Confirm the nightly push from Dellingport lands in /inbound/korvix and that checksums match the manifest. If the drop is stale (>6h), page the Brightmoor support rotation and halt the ceremony. Support owns re-triggering the transfer; do not rotate the drop credentials mid-ceremony. Once the drop is confirmed current, record it in the ceremony log. The passphrase to restore the transfer keyring follows.

strongbox words: jorix-norys-aldius-druax

### Step 4: Enable the Contrast Audit Service

After migrating the Tintcheck pipeline, the color-contrast audit runs as a standalone service rather than a build plugin. It scans rendered pages from the Quillbrook preview cluster and flags ratios below threshold. No user data is stored; reports are retained for thirty days. Review the service account scopes before approving rollout. The service reads its runtime settings from the following configuration block.

settings of tagef-bawif:
DRUIX_HOST=druix.zemvarlabs.internal
DRUIX_PORT=8000